Starting at Hookipa Beach Park: The Coastal Classic with a Twist
Your day begins early at Baldwin Beach Park, from where you’ll head to Hookipa Beach Park, a well-loved surf spot famous for powerful waves and sea turtle sightings. We loved the way the guide pointed out the green honu basking on the shore—these gentle creatures add a spiritual layer to your Maui experience. Watching surfers carve through the waves gives a lively start, but it’s the sea turtles that truly steal the scene. This stop sets the tone: Maui’s coast is vibrant, alive, and full of stories.
Rainbow Eucalyptus Trees: Nature’s Kaleidoscope
Next, you’ll stroll beneath the rainbow eucalyptus trees, a natural wonder whose bark peels away in rainbow hues—reds, oranges, greens, and blues. These trees are among Maui’s most photographed natural features. We appreciated how the guide explained the significance of these trees in Hawaiian culture and their unique bark that’s constantly shedding, creating a living canvas. It’s a perfect spot for photos and an easy way to connect with Maui’s botanical diversity.

Keanae Point: Old Hawaii in Modern Form
Your journey then takes you to Keanae, a historic fishing village surrounded by taro fields and rugged lava rock shores. Here, we loved the authentic feel—no glossy resorts, just traditional Hawaiian homes and a chance to hear stories of past generations. The dramatic lava terrain and the sound of the pounding surf create an almost meditative atmosphere. It’s the kind of place that makes you feel connected to the land and the ancestors who once thrived here.

Red Sand Beach: Maui’s Unique Coastal Wonder
After the waterfall, you’ll relax at Red Sand Beach (Kaihalulu)—a striking cove where crimson-colored cliffs meet turquoise waters. It’s a rugged, natural marvel and one of Maui’s most photogenic beaches. The walk down involves some uneven terrain, so comfortable shoes are recommended, but the view is worth it. Many guests mention how special this place feels, away from crowded resorts.
